Silica sand is commonly used as an important component for horse arena surfaces. The specific type of silica sand used for horse arenas is typically referred to as equestrian sand or arena sand. The primary purpose is to provide a stable and well-draining surface suitable for horse riding and training activities.
The specific requirements for equestrian sand may vary depending on factors such as climate, usage intensity, and the preferences of riders. Some arenas may also incorporate additives to further enhance stability, cushioning, or moisture retention.
